Lisa Ono is bringing her romantic masterpieces to Shanghai on Chinese Valentine’s Day.

The Brazilian-born musician, who moved to Japan at the age of 10, started singing and playing the guitar five years after her arrival in the Asian country. 

Since her debut in 1989, Ono has received huge acclaim for her performances, which feature her natural voice, rhythmic guitar playing and her heart-melting smile. 

The 55-year-old singer has been active in America, Brazil and most Asian countries. 

Her debut in China made her one of the most popular Japanese singers among Chinese audiences.

Ono has released more than 30 albums including “Nana,” “Bossa Carioca,” “Pretty World,” “Dans Mon Ile,” “Check To Check” and “Look To The Rainbow” and she presents numerous covers of classic jazz chansons with her own arrangements, such as “La Vie En Rose,” “Fly Me To The Moon” and “Don’t Know Why.”

Ono’s mixture of Brazilian bossa nova and samba elements with Japanese styles make her special in the field of jazz music.
